Looking at different areas of Brooklyn and have found a lot of info on Bay Ridge and Bensonhurst, but not much on Sunset Park and Gravesend. Can anyone tell me what these areas are like? I'm basically looking for a quiet neighbourhood, easy commute to Lower Manhattan, (generally) safe, and has studios/1 bedrooms for around $950-1100. I have lived in majority Asian/Eastern European neighbourhoods in other cities, so diversity is no problem.

Sunset park is mainly Hispanic and Chinese, so it kinda sticks out considering its location in Brooklyn.

As for Gravesend, it's basically a more bland, slightly more trashy version of Bensonhurst. Not a bad neighborhood and definitly safe, but seems very average to me. In fact, I read somewhere that a lot of Gravesend residents often mistaken their neighborhood as Bensonhurst since both neighborhoods are so similar.
